Engaging Theology: A Biblical, Historical, and Practical ~ Engaging Theology is an introductory theology textbook that grounds a treatment of standard systematic topics in the wider context of life and practice and shows the relevance of each doctrine to the church. The book treats the essential doctrines of Christian orthodoxy by following the pattern of story, doctrinal exposition, theological .

Engaging Theology: A Biblical, Historical, and Practical Int ~ Engaging Theology: A Biblical, Historical, and Practical Introduction- Theology today is faced with increasing amounts of religious and theological pl. . this book shows that key elements of Christian theology ground an integrated worldview and are essential for spiritual formation.

Engaging Theology: A Biblical, Historical, and Practical ~ Story: Each chapter begins with a brief and engaging account of the historical situation out of which the doctrine arose or where it played an essential role in the development of the church, showing students that orthodox theology matters and introducing them to most of the key theologians in the history of the church.

Evangelical Theology: A Biblical and Systematic Introduction ~ Evangelical Theology is a systematic theology written from the perspective of a biblical scholar. Michael F. Bird contends that the center, unity, and boundary of the evangelical faith is the evangel (= gospel), as opposed to things like justification by faith or inerrancy.
